- 'Importance of Being Earnest'.
- Witty dialogue
- Sarcasm or Irony.
- Contrived situations; arranged or created in a way which, seems unrealistic, fake or artificial.
- Critiques of society (marriage).
- Untitled
- Portrayals of class differences.
- Contrasts of urban and rural. (Jack in town, Ernest in country)
- Satire.
- Incongruity; being inappropriate, unsuitable in situation.
- Slaptick; clmsy actions and embarrassing events.
- Hyperbole; exaggerated situation that are not meant to be taken seriously.
- Exaggeration
- Parody; deliberate exaggeration for comedic effect.
- Deadpan; still or non-expressive face when something is comedic.
- Puns; variety meaning of the word, creating humour.
- Double entendre; figure of speech with 2 meanings.one meaning is obvious, whilst other is innuendo which is indecent but still comedic in social awkwardness.
